Kiyle is a boy’s name of English origin, meaning “A modern, created name likely derived from the popular 'Kyle'. It has no specific traditional meaning.”, and peaked in popularity in 1998.

Kiyle is a modern creation from English origins, likely a contemporary take on the well-known name Kyle. It offers a familiar sound with a fresh, distinctive spelling.
